libreport version: 2.0.8 executable: /usr/bin/python hashmarkername: setroubleshoot kernel: 3.1.0-7.fc16.i686 reason: SELinux is preventing /bin/bash from 'read' accesses on the file /bin/bash. time: Thu 12 Jan 2012 04:45:58 PM EST description: :SELinux is preventing /bin/bash from 'read' accesses on the file /bin/bash. : :***** Plugin catchall (100. confidence) suggests *************************** : :If you believe that bash should be allowed read access on the bash file by default. :Then you should report this as a bug. :You can generate a local policy module to allow this access. :Do :allow this access for now by executing: :# grep aisexec /var/log/audit/audit.log | audit2allow -M mypol :# semodule -i mypol.pp : :Additional Information: :Source Context system_u:system_r:aisexec_t:SystemLow :Target Context system_u:object_r:shell_exec_t:SystemLow :Target Objects /bin/bash [ file ] :Source aisexec :Source Path /bin/bash :Port <Unknown> :Host (removed) :Source RPM Packages bash-4.2.20-1.fc16 :Target RPM Packages bash-4.2.20-1.fc16 :Policy RPM selinux-policy-3.10.0-71.fc16 :Selinux Enabled True :Policy Type targeted :Enforcing Mode Enforcing :Host Name (removed) :Platform Linux (removed) 3.1.0-7.fc16.i686 #1 SMP Tue Nov 1 : 21:00:16 UTC 2011 i686 i686 :Alert Count 1 :First Seen Thu 12 Jan 2012 04:45:33 PM EST :Last Seen Thu 12 Jan 2012 04:45:33 PM EST :Local ID e6f3d1a4-08b8-4bad-8138-54c68bed0609 : :Raw Audit Messages :type=AVC msg=audit(1326404733.7:624): avc: denied { read } for pid=3473 comm="aisexec" path="/bin/bash" dev=dm-1 ino=7547 scontext=system_u:system_r:aisexec_t:s0 tcontext=system_u:object_r:shell_exec_t:s0 tclass=file : : :type=SYSCALL msg=audit(1326404733.7:624): arch=i386 syscall=mprotect success=no exit=EACCES a0=811c000 a1=1000 a2=1 a3=41d568f8 items=0 ppid=3456 pid=3473 auid=4294967295 uid=0 gid=0 euid=0 suid=0 fsuid=0 egid=0 sgid=0 fsgid=0 tty=(none) ses=4294967295 comm=aisexec exe=/bin/bash subj=system_u:system_r:aisexec_t:s0 key=(null) : :Hash: aisexec,aisexec_t,shell_exec_t,file,read : :audit2allow : :#============= aisexec_t ============== :allow aisexec_t shell_exec_t:file read; : :audit2allow -R : :#============= aisexec_t ============== :allow aisexec_t shell_exec_t:file read; :
Fixed in selinux-policy-3.10.0-72.fc16
